The Red Devils have already considerably strengthened their attack by completing deals for Matheus Cunha and Bryan Mbeumo this summer. And it arose at the end of last month that United Sesko had identified as their primary no 9 -purpose white prior to the new Premier League season.
Sesko, 22, has not had a shortage of voorags this summer, with Arsenal and Newcastle also admirers of the Slovenia International.
But United has won the race for Sesko's signature after he agreed a deal that is simply shy of £ 73 million including add-ons for the RB Leipzig-Man.

Both players struggled for goals last season, hence United's offer to add more firepower to their team in the summer transfer window.
In total, United only registered 44 goals in the Premier League for 38 games when they recorded their lowest finish ever in 15th place. Only Everton and the three relegated teams – Southampton, Ipswich Town and Leicester – scored less.
The aim of Manchester United on Sesko has fueled speculation that Hojlund could be sold. But the Dane insisted that he wanted to stay and fight for his place in the team during the recent pre-season tour of the club.
“I think my plan is very clear and that is for me to keep fighting for my place, whatever happens,” he said. “I am still very young. I think people sometimes forget that. I am only 22. Of course, not every striker at the age of 22 scores 100 goals (such as Erling Haaland).
“But I learned a lot, I think you can see in my game. I am starting to develop and get even better in the base. Now it is almost for me to grind myself and I have done it very well in the preseason so far. Just concentrate on continuing that.
“The competition is fine for me. It sharpened me. I am more than ready. I feel sharp, so I welcome everything that comes. I think it is good with the competition and it just sharpenes the team.”
